簡單易學的學生信息表數據庫代碼
在當今的數字時代,數據庫的使用已成為各種應用程序和系統的基礎。對於學生管理系統來說,建立一個有效的學生信息表數據庫是至關重要的。本文將介紹如何創建一個簡單易學的學生信息表數據庫代碼,並提供相應的示例代碼,幫助讀者更好地理解數據庫的基本操作。
數據庫的基本概念
數據庫是一種有組織的數據集合,通常用於存儲、管理和檢索信息。對於學生信息表來說,數據庫可以用來存儲學生的基本信息,如姓名、學號、年齡、性別、專業等。這些信息可以幫助學校或教育機構更好地管理學生資料。
選擇數據庫管理系統
在開始編寫學生信息表的數據庫代碼之前,首先需要選擇一個合適的數據庫管理系統(DBMS)。常見的選擇包括 MySQL、PostgreSQL 和 SQLite 等。這些系統都提供了強大的功能來支持數據的存儲和檢索。
創建學生信息表
以下是使用 MySQL 創建學生信息表的基本 SQL 語句:
CREATE TABLE students (
student_id INT AUTO_INCREMENT PRIMARY KEY,
name VARCHAR(100) NOT NULL,
age INT NOT NULL,
gender ENUM('男', '女') NOT NULL,
major VARCHAR(100) NOT NULL
);
在這段代碼中,我們創建了一個名為 students
的表,並定義了五個字段:
student_id
: 學生的唯一標識符,使用自動增量的整數。name
: 學生的姓名,使用變長字符串。age
: 學生的年齡,使用整數。gender
: 學生的性別,使用枚舉類型。major
: 學生的專業,使用變長字符串。
插入數據
創建表後,我們可以使用以下 SQL 語句向表中插入數據:
INSERT INTO students (name, age, gender, major) VALUES
('張三', 20, '男', '計算機科學'),
('李四', 22, '女', '電子工程');
這段代碼將兩名學生的基本信息插入到 students
表中。
查詢數據
要查詢學生信息,可以使用以下 SQL 語句:
SELECT * FROM students;
這將返回 students
表中的所有記錄。如果只想查詢特定的學生,可以使用條件語句:
SELECT * FROM students WHERE gender = '女';
更新和刪除數據
如果需要更新學生的信息,可以使用以下 SQL 語句:
UPDATE students SET age = 21 WHERE name = '張三';
要刪除某個學生的記錄,可以使用:
DELETE FROM students WHERE student_id = 1;
總結
本文介紹了如何創建一個簡單的學生信息表數據庫,包括表的創建、數據的插入、查詢、更新和刪除等基本操作。這些基本的 SQL 語句可以幫助初學者快速上手數據庫的使用,並為進一步的學習打下基礎。
如果您對於更高效的數據管理有興趣,考慮使用 VPS 來搭建您的數據庫環境,這樣可以獲得更好的性能和靈活性。無論是 香港VPS 還是其他類型的 伺服器,都能為您的項目提供穩定的支持。